400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el文字有个引号

作者:路由通
|
384人看过
发布时间:2026-02-09 18:07:18
标签:
在微软电子表格软件中,单元格文字前方出现引号是一个常见现象,其背后涉及数据导入、格式处理、特殊字符转义及软件兼容性等多重技术原因。本文将深入剖析这一符号的十二个核心成因,涵盖从外部数据引入时的文本标识机制,到软件为防止自动格式转换而添加的隐形保护层,再到特定函数与操作触发的显示规则。通过理解这些原理,用户能更精准地掌控数据,避免常见的数据处理陷阱,提升办公效率。
为什么excel文字有个引号

       在日常使用微软电子表格软件处理数据时,许多用户都曾遇到过一种令人困惑的情况:单元格中的文字前方,突兀地显示着一个单引号。这个符号并非用户手动输入,却顽固地停留在那里,有时在编辑栏可见,有时则仅作为单元格内容的一部分隐形存在。这不仅仅是一个简单的显示问题,其背后牵涉到软件底层的数据处理逻辑、格式兼容性设计以及对特殊字符的转义机制。理解这个小小引号的来龙去脉,是掌握数据清洗、导入导出以及格式控制等高级技巧的关键一步。本文将为您层层剥茧,揭示其背后十二个深层次的原因。

       一、源自外部数据导入的文本标识符

       当您从文本文件、网页或其他数据库系统中将数据导入电子表格时,软件为了准确区分纯文本与可能具有特殊格式的数据,会采用一种保守策略。在诸如逗号分隔值文件等格式中,系统常用双引号将每个字段的值包裹起来,以明确字段的边界,尤其是在字段内容本身包含逗号或换行符时。在导入过程中,如果源数据中的某个文本字段被引号包裹,处理程序有时会将这些引号作为数据的一部分保留,或者在转换过程中,为了确保文本的纯粹性,在内部为其添加一个单引号前缀,以此向软件引擎声明:“此单元格内容应被强制识别为文本格式,无论其内容看似什么。”这是一种从源头确保数据完整性的常见做法。

       二、软件自动添加的格式保护机制

       这是引号出现最常见的原因之一。软件具备强大的自动格式识别功能,例如,当您输入一串以“0”开头的数字(如工号“001”)或看起来像日期、公式的内容时,软件会自作主张地将其转换为数值、日期或尝试计算公式。为了阻止这种自动转换,用户或在某些自动流程中,软件本身会在内容前添加一个单引号。这个单引号在单元格中通常不显示,但在编辑栏中可见。它的作用如同一个“封印”,明确告知处理引擎:“忽略此单元格的自动格式规则,将其中所有字符原封不动地视为文本。”这是一种主动的防御性措施。

       三、特殊字符输入的转义需求

       在某些特定场景下,用户需要输入以等号、加号或减号开头的字符串。由于这些符号在软件中被默认为公式的开始,直接输入会导致软件尝试将其作为公式解析并报错。为了输入这些特殊字符本身,用户可以在其前方添加一个单引号。例如,要显示“=已完成”,直接输入会导致错误,而输入“'=已完成”则能正常显示。此时,单引号作为一个转义字符,取消了后续等号的特殊语法含义,使其回归普通文本字符的身份。

       四、从网页复制粘贴带来的隐藏格式

       从网页中复制表格或文本后粘贴到电子表格中,是一个高频操作。网页代码中常常包含大量肉眼不可见的格式控制符、超文本标记语言实体或特殊的空白字符。在粘贴过程中,软件为了忠实地还原您所看到的网页文本内容,并处理其中可能存在的格式冲突,有时会自动在单元格内容前添加单引号,以确保这段来源复杂的内容能够被稳定地存储为文本,避免因残留的代码片段引发不可预知的格式混乱或计算错误。

       五、特定函数公式运算后的文本化结果

       一些函数的运算结果,尤其是那些涉及文本连接或从其他系统获取数据的函数,可能会在返回的文本字符串开头包含引号。例如,在使用某些查询函数或通过组件对象模型与外部程序交互获取数据时,返回的字符串可能被封装在引号内。当这些结果被填入单元格时,引号便一同被带了进来。此外,使用文本连接符手工构建特定格式字符串时,如果操作不当,也可能意外地将引号作为文本的一部分合并进去。

       六、单元格“文本”格式的事先设定

       如果您在输入内容之前,已经手动将目标单元格的格式设置为了“文本”,那么此后在该单元格中输入的任何内容,包括数字,都将被当作文本处理。在这种模式下,软件内部可能会以添加单引号前缀的方式记录此数据属性。虽然单元格格式本身已能控制显示和计算方式,但单引号作为一种底层标记,进一步强化了“此乃文本,勿作他解”的指令,尤其在后续的数据交换或复杂计算中起到关键标识作用。

       七、软件版本或区域设置兼容性遗留

       不同版本的软件,或者同一版本但不同区域设置下,对于数据格式的处理细节可能存在微小差异。在较旧版本中创建或保存的文件,用新版本打开时,为了保持最大程度的兼容性,确保原有数据显示无误,系统可能会采用更为保守的策略,为某些可能存在歧义的数据添加单引号标记。同样,在不同语言或区域设置间共享文件时,为避免日期、数字格式的自动转换引发错误,引号也可能作为一种安全措施被引入。

       八、使用公式间接生成的文本前缀

       某些公式组合可能会动态生成以引号开头的结果。例如,使用连接函数将一个包含引号的字符串与其他内容合并时,如果源字符串中本身带有引号,那么合并后的结果自然就包含了引号。又或者,在利用宏或脚本进行自动化处理时,编程代码中明确指定了在字符串两端添加引号以符合某种输出规范,当这些结果输出到单元格时,引号便随之呈现。这并非错误,而是程序化操作的预期结果。

       九、操作系统剪贴板数据格式的影响

       当您在不同的应用程序之间复制和粘贴数据时,剪贴板中实际上可能存储了同一数据的多种格式版本。电子表格软件在粘贴时,会尝试选择最合适的一种格式进行解析。如果来自源程序的数据在某种格式描述中被标记为“带引号的文本字符串”,那么软件在采用这种格式进行粘贴时,就会将引号作为数据本身的一部分接收过来。这通常发生在从专业数据库工具、集成开发环境或某些文本编辑器中复制数据时。

       十、清除格式操作后的残留效应

       用户有时会对单元格使用“清除格式”功能,希望只保留纯文本。然而,这个操作清除的是单元格的数字格式、字体颜色等显示属性,但并不会移除作为数据内容一部分的单引号字符。因此,如果一个单元格原本因为格式保护而带有隐形的单引号前缀,清除格式后,这个单引号可能从“隐形”状态变为“显形”,在单元格中直接显示出来,因为控制其隐形的格式属性已经被移除了。

       十一、自定义数字格式中的文字占位符误解

       在设置自定义数字格式时,用户可以使用双引号来包裹希望直接显示的文本。例如,自定义格式为“类型:”,其中代表单元格中输入的内容。如果用户误解了该格式的用法,或者在编辑过程中出现了误操作,可能导致格式代码本身的部分字符(包括引号)被异常地显示为单元格内容。虽然这不常见,但在处理极其复杂的自定义格式时,确实可能引发令人困惑的显示问题。

       十二、修复超长数字显示问题的副作用

       在处理超过十五位的长数字时,软件会默认以科学计数法显示,导致精度丢失。为了完整显示如身份证号、银行卡号等长串数字,用户必须先将单元格格式设为“文本”,然后再输入数字。在这个过程中,如果用户直接输入数字,发现显示异常后,再回头将格式改为文本,有时软件会自动在已输入的数字前加上单引号,以强制其转为文本格式并完整显示。这是软件提供的一种补救措施,旨在帮助用户挽回可能已丢失的数据精度。

       识别与处理引号的方法

       要判断引号是显示字符还是格式标记,最直接的方法是选中单元格并查看编辑栏。如果编辑栏中内容开头有单引号,而单元格内没有,则它是格式标记。如果编辑栏和单元格内都有,那它就是数据内容的一部分。要去除作为格式标记的单引号,可以选中单元格,将其格式改为“常规”,然后按功能键重新进入编辑状态再确认即可。但需谨慎,此举可能重新触发自动格式转换。要去除作为数据内容的引号,可以使用查找替换功能,将单引号替换为空。

       引号在数据交换中的关键角色

       在进行数据导出,尤其是生成逗号分隔值文件时,电子表格软件会自动为所有文本字段添加双引号作为限定符,以确保字段的完整性。这是数据交换的标准实践。因此,当您再次将这些文件导入时,看到引号也就不足为奇了。理解这一流程,有助于您在系统间迁移数据时,预先做好清洗和格式准备,避免引号造成的重复嵌套或解析错误。

       预防非预期引号的实用建议

       为减少工作中遇到意外引号的困扰,可以养成几个好习惯:在输入长数字、以特殊符号开头的内容前,先预置单元格格式为“文本”;从外部源粘贴数据后,使用“选择性粘贴”中的“数值”选项,可以剥离大部分隐藏格式;对于需要批量处理的数据,在导入时仔细预览并设置好数据列格式;定期使用修剪函数清理数据两端的不可见字符。

       总而言之,单元格文字前的引号绝非程序漏洞或无意义的瑕疵,它是软件在复杂的数据处理环境中,为平衡自动化智能与数据完整性所采用的一系列策略的显性痕迹。从强制文本格式、转义特殊字符,到保障数据交换兼容,这个小符号承载着重要的功能使命。深度理解其产生的原因,不仅能帮助您高效解决眼前的数据显示问题,更能让您洞悉电子表格软件底层的数据处理哲学,从而更加游刃有余地驾驭数据,提升整体办公自动化水平。当您再次与这个引号不期而遇时,希望本文能成为您快速诊断并解决问题的得力指南。

       

相关文章
excel列表名字是什么原因
Excel表格中列表名称的设定看似简单,却常因理解不清导致操作困扰。本文将深入剖析列表名称的十二个核心成因,涵盖其底层逻辑、命名规则、数据关联性及常见错误。从工作表标签的实质到结构化引用中的角色,从命名冲突的根源到跨工作簿引用的机制,我们将逐一拆解,并提供权威的实践指南,帮助您彻底掌握这一基础而关键的概念,提升数据处理效率。
2026-02-09 18:07:04
273人看过
为什么新建的EXCEL表很大
你是否曾遇到过这样的情况:明明只是新建了一个空白的电子表格文件,文件体积却异常庞大,动辄几兆甚至几十兆?这种看似反常的现象背后,其实隐藏着电子表格软件复杂的工作原理、默认设置以及用户操作习惯等多重原因。本文将深入剖析导致新建表格文件体积过大的十二个核心因素,从软件基础架构、格式特性到具体操作细节,为您提供全面的解析与实用的解决方案,帮助您从根本上理解和控制电子表格文件的大小。
2026-02-09 18:06:49
328人看过
为什么word里图片显示半个
在Word文档编辑过程中,图片仅显示一半或部分缺失是用户常遇到的棘手问题。这一现象背后涉及多个技术层面因素,包括段落行距设置、图片环绕方式、画布与文本框限制、文档兼容性以及软件自身缓存等。本文将系统性地剖析十二个核心成因,并提供一系列经过验证的解决方案与预防策略,旨在帮助用户从根源上理解和解决图片显示异常,提升文档编辑的效率与专业性。
2026-02-09 18:06:44
348人看过
excel为什么会显示缺少示例
当微软Excel(Microsoft Excel)用户遇到“缺少示例”提示时,往往意味着软件在尝试执行某些智能操作,例如数据填充或公式预测时,未能从用户提供的数据中识别出足够清晰或一致的模式。这一提示背后涉及数据格式、操作逻辑及软件设置等多重因素。理解其成因并掌握对应的排查与解决方法,能够有效提升数据处理效率,避免工作流程中断。本文将深入剖析十二个核心原因并提供详细实用的解决方案。
2026-02-09 18:06:26
120人看过
为什么word有的页面删不掉
在日常使用微软Word处理文档时,许多用户都曾遇到一个令人困惑的问题:明明只想删除某个空白页或无用的页面,却无论如何操作都无法将其移除。这背后往往并非简单的操作失误,而是由分页符、节、表格或段落格式等多种深层因素共同导致的结果。本文将深入剖析导致Word页面无法删除的十二个核心原因,并提供一系列经过验证的实用解决方案,帮助您彻底掌握文档编辑的主动权,高效清理冗余页面。
2026-02-09 18:06:04
133人看过
为什么word图表复制会丢失
在日常工作中,许多用户会遇到将Microsoft Word(微软文字处理软件)中的图表复制到其他程序时,内容丢失或格式错乱的问题。这并非简单的操作失误,其背后涉及软件底层架构差异、数据嵌入原理、对象模型兼容性以及用户操作习惯等多重复杂因素。本文将深入剖析导致这一现象的十二个关键原因,从图形设备接口(GDI)与矢量渲染的冲突,到对象链接与嵌入(OLE)技术的局限,再到不同软件间剪贴板数据交换的“语言障碍”,为您提供一份全面、专业且实用的深度解析。理解这些原理,不仅能帮助您有效避免数据丢失,更能提升跨平台文档处理的效率与规范性。
2026-02-09 18:05:58
341人看过